THE STORY BEHIND THE PICTURE : The basic idea behind this project is to create one hero and one villain who are in opposition to one another. Many of the characters will obviously be inspired by existing characters, like Spider-Man inspired Arachnic and Venom inspired Scorpio. Others will be inspired on a purely thematic level, like Apex is inspired by the basic premise behind Superman.
